Job description
Overview

Our large Property Maintenance Client is looking to recruit 1x Repairs Scheduler Planner's and 1 x Senior Planner/Team Leader who will be based in their office in their Potters Bar Office (EN6). Please note this is temp role for 12 weeks, with a view for a permanent role.

Hours: Monday to Friday (8:00am to 5:00pm) Office Based

Responsibilities
  • Plan and Schedule works in for operatives
  • To monitor and oversee all daily services ensuring they are allocated to relevant engineers
  • To investigate service appointments that have had repeat visits and highlight to Contract Managers/Clients as and when necessary
  • To monitor all work orders as they enter the computerised repairs system
  • Responsible for ensuring team members are inducted and adequately trained to fulfil their duties
  • Investigating complaints/ queries
Qualifications
  • Scheduling/Planning experience in Social Housing
  • Previous experience in the Construction Admin/Social Housing sector
  • Attention to detail
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ills
  • Computer skills/ IT illiterate
